Policy interface

Antarmuka yang mewakili Kebijakan.

Metode

beginCreate(string, string, string, PolicyCreateOptionalParams)

Membuat kebijakan.

beginCreateAndWait(string, string, string, PolicyCreateOptionalParams)

Membuat kebijakan.

beginDelete(string, string, string, PolicyDeleteOptionalParams)

Menghapus kebijakan.

beginDeleteAndWait(string, string, string, PolicyDeleteOptionalParams)

Menghapus kebijakan.

get(string, string, string, PolicyGetOptionalParams)

Mendapatkan detail kebijakan.

list(string, string, PolicyListOptionalParams)

Mendapatkan daftar kebijakan dalam vault yang diberikan.

Detail Metode

beginCreate(string, string, string, PolicyCreateOptionalParams)

Membuat kebijakan.

function beginCreate(resourceGroupName: string, vaultName: string, policyName: string, options?: PolicyCreateOptionalParams): Promise<SimplePollerLike<OperationState<PolicyModel>, PolicyModel>>

Parameter

resourceGroupName

string

Nama grup sumber daya. Nama tidak sensitif terhadap penggunaan huruf besar atau kecil.

vaultName

string

Nama brankas.

policyName

string

Nama kebijakan.

options
PolicyCreateOptionalParams

Parameter opsi.

Mengembalikan

Promise<@azure/core-lro.SimplePollerLike<OperationState<PolicyModel>, PolicyModel>>

beginCreateAndWait(string, string, string, PolicyCreateOptionalParams)

Membuat kebijakan.

function beginCreateAndWait(resourceGroupName: string, vaultName: string, policyName: string, options?: PolicyCreateOptionalParams): Promise<PolicyModel>

Parameter

resourceGroupName

string

Nama grup sumber daya. Nama tidak sensitif terhadap penggunaan huruf besar atau kecil.

vaultName

string

Nama brankas.

policyName

string

Nama kebijakan.

options
PolicyCreateOptionalParams

Parameter opsi.

Mengembalikan

Promise<PolicyModel>

beginDelete(string, string, string, PolicyDeleteOptionalParams)

Menghapus kebijakan.

function beginDelete(resourceGroupName: string, vaultName: string, policyName: string, options?: PolicyDeleteOptionalParams): Promise<SimplePollerLike<OperationState<PolicyDeleteHeaders>, PolicyDeleteHeaders>>

Parameter

resourceGroupName

string

Nama grup sumber daya. Nama tidak sensitif terhadap penggunaan huruf besar atau kecil.

vaultName

string

Nama brankas.

policyName

string

Nama kebijakan.

options
PolicyDeleteOptionalParams

Parameter opsi.

Mengembalikan

Promise<@azure/core-lro.SimplePollerLike<OperationState<PolicyDeleteHeaders>, PolicyDeleteHeaders>>

beginDeleteAndWait(string, string, string, PolicyDeleteOptionalParams)

Menghapus kebijakan.

function beginDeleteAndWait(resourceGroupName: string, vaultName: string, policyName: string, options?: PolicyDeleteOptionalParams): Promise<PolicyDeleteHeaders>

Parameter

resourceGroupName

string

Nama grup sumber daya. Nama tidak sensitif terhadap penggunaan huruf besar atau kecil.

vaultName

string

Nama brankas.

policyName

string

Nama kebijakan.

options
PolicyDeleteOptionalParams

Parameter opsi.

Mengembalikan

get(string, string, string, PolicyGetOptionalParams)

Mendapatkan detail kebijakan.

function get(resourceGroupName: string, vaultName: string, policyName: string, options?: PolicyGetOptionalParams): Promise<PolicyModel>

Parameter

resourceGroupName

string

Nama grup sumber daya. Nama tidak sensitif terhadap penggunaan huruf besar atau kecil.

vaultName

string

Nama brankas.

policyName

string

Nama kebijakan.

options
PolicyGetOptionalParams

Parameter opsi.

Mengembalikan

Promise<PolicyModel>

list(string, string, PolicyListOptionalParams)

Mendapatkan daftar kebijakan dalam vault yang diberikan.

function list(resourceGroupName: string, vaultName: string, options?: PolicyListOptionalParams): PagedAsyncIterableIterator<PolicyModel, PolicyModel[], PageSettings>

Parameter

resourceGroupName

string

Nama grup sumber daya. Nama tidak sensitif terhadap penggunaan huruf besar atau kecil.

vaultName

string

Nama brankas.

options
PolicyListOptionalParams

Parameter opsi.

Mengembalikan